Abstract

Faced with intense market competition, enterprises need to pay increasing attention to innovation and new product development. However, innovation in new product development is a kind of highly risky exploration. Once the new product fails, enterprises will suffer enormously. Recognizing the growing importance of the innovation in new product development and the necessity of a better management process for its success, this paper proposes an assessment model to determine and analyze the innovation risks factors in new product development process. Based on a case study, the paper concludes with strategic recommendations for managers and some propositions for future academic research.
